Sister Alvear is the resident expert on HH, she has lived there and I believe her mother still lives there.

I have visited there, we enjoyed the food and the tours, they make some fabulous fine furniture. We sensed an underlying bondage and legalism, also question why most of the residents live in mobile homes, when they are such artisans and craftsmen?

Many of the folks came from the NY area with the founder Blair Adams.

No I did not live there but was closely associated with them for a time...my missionary mother lived there and is buried there...I became associated with them because of her. There are many good things there ...I love farming and simple life but I do not agree with their doctrines as a whole. Many of the people are the sweetest people you could ever meet but are in a system that is in my simple opinion very cruel. I don't like shunning for one thing...Of course there might be a time for that but not because someone leaves a fellowship...It is hard to explain ...
